Swimming Competes in ESU Invite

EAST STROUDSBURG, Pa. (Feb. 4, 2008)- The Pioneers traveled to the East Stroudsburg University for the ESU Invite at Koehler Fieldhouse, and came away with nine individual event wins, a new school record, several personal-best times, and two championship qualifications.
           
Sophomore Jennifer Esposito (Lindenhurst, N.Y.) won the 50-yard freestyle with a time of 24.52, the 100-yard butterfly with a time of 56.69 and the 200-yard freestyle with a final time of 1:52.96, which set a new C.W. Post school record, as well as qualifying Esposito for the NCAA championships in that event.          
           
Junior Stephanie Palmeri (Seaford, N.Y.) placed first in the 1650 freestyle with a time of 18:38.08, and also swam a lifetime best 1:00.81 in the 100-yard butterfly. 
           
Freshman Riley Cassidy (Cambridge, Ontario) touched the wall first in the 400 yard IM, with a time of 4:44.55, taking more then 10 seconds of her previous time, and qualifying her for the ECAC Championship meet to be held at the end of February in Pittsburgh, Pa.   
           
Other individual winners for the Pioneers were freshman Sofi Mathsson (Stockholm, Sweden), who won the 200-yard butterfly with a time of 2:12.12, and Brittany Roman-Green (Woodstock, N.Y.), who won the 200-yard IM with a time of 2:20.16.
       
     The 200 yard medley relay team of sophomore Morgan Feliccia (Arnold, Md.), senior Paula Braband (Bethpage, N.Y.), Cassidy and Roman-Green won with a time of 1 minute, 58.03 seconds.  The 200-yard freestyle relay team of Palmeri, Braband, sophomore Josephine Tjernstrom (Bromma, Sweden), and Cassidy won the event with a time of 1:43.66. 
           
The Pioneers will now begin preparations for the post-season, and the first event on their schedule is the Metropolitan Championships, held Feb. 22-24 in Piscataway, N.J.
